1) On the surface you are correct, and I'd also like to keep Shaheed.
2) You are not accounting for the financial aspect. We are a team with a lot of talent needs & cap relief. We cannot keep everybody that we'd like, financials aside, and still be able to actually pay them.
3) It depends on how we hit on the draft picks. If we get a 3rd and select a WR would you be upset or happy if in his first 4 years he has the same stat line as Shaheed listed below? Now consider we'd only be paying him maximum average of $1.5M/yr on a rookie contract versus $17M+ that Shaheed will likely get and will have to greatly increase his current production, like his best season thus far would have to be his absolute floor to not be considered a terrible contract.
4) You are gambling just as much on Shaheed taking a big step up in the future as you are of Vele not panning out. Though I do give you that Shaheed statistically is on pace for his best season barring injuries, and we have not properly utilized Vele.
5) Statistically, prior to 2025, they are not as far apart as people think.
6) 2025 & beyond we have to figure how to best utilize them both. Shaheed should not be averaging just 11.3ypc unless he's going to be your trusted blanket to get open type WR1 and replace Olave. Vele halfway through his 2nd season cannot only have total what amounts to essentially 1 game of production from his rookie season. Both of these issues are on Moore in the same way that we are not using Kamara & Hill properly.
Vele
2024: 41rec/475yd/3TD
2025: 5rec/39yd/1TD
Shaheed
2022: 28rec/488yd/2TD
2023: 46rec/719yd/5TD
2024: 20rec/349yd/3TD
2025: 44rec/499yd/2TD
